It is not really about which screen technology is better or which type of screen that Hayabusha might have that we were arguing about! It is about the "stupid beliefs" of wort1000 that 100% percent OLED screen exists without active-matrix or passive matrix, and that all big OLED screens from Sony devices are not AMOLED and are 100% percent OLED. These silly claims are "unfounded" and "illogical". All OLED screens that are in the market right nowand will be, and the ones that had been in before are all AMOLED. Every display screen whether LCD, CRT or Plasma uses addressing schemes. In the case of OLED, only Matrix addressing is can be used, which is either active-matrix or passive-matrix. But as we all know, active-matrix is the the best option for high resolution and big displays as PMOLED, due to huge power requirement is quite hard to make. What I saying are well-established fact.
